United Methodist Women

United Methodist Women is a community of women whose purpose is to know God and to experience freedom as whole persons through Jesus Christ; to develop a creative, supportive fellowship; and to expand concepts of mission through participation in the global ministries of the church. UMW is the largest women's organization in the world, evolving from a commitment to mission and Christian service.  All women are invited to join one of our three UMW circle meeting groups who meet monthly, two during the day and one in the evening.
